What Is Market Cap and Why Does It Matter?

Market capitalization—often shortened to market cap—is calculated by multiplying a cryptocurrency’s current price by its circulating supply. Unlike price alone, market cap offers a more accurate reflection of an asset’s overall value and investor confidence.

For example, a coin priced at $1 with 10 billion in circulation has a $10 billion market cap—potentially more significant than a $100 coin with only 10 million units available. This distinction is crucial when evaluating the top crypto by market cap, as it helps investors assess relative strength and resilience.

Bitcoin (BTC): The Pioneer of Digital Currency

Bitcoin remains the undisputed leader in market cap, valued at $1.94 trillion in mid-February 2025. As the first decentralized cryptocurrency, BTC introduced the world to blockchain technology and peer-to-peer value transfer.

Ethereum (ETH): The Engine of Smart Contracts

With a market cap of $327.02 billion, Ethereum ranks second and serves as the backbone of decentralized applications (dApps), DeFi, and NFTs.

Solana (SOL): High-Speed Blockchain Innovation

Solana boasts a market cap of $99.96 billion, thanks to its blazing-fast transaction speeds and low fees—powered by its unique Proof-of-History (PoH) mechanism.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: Why is Bitcoin still the top crypto by market cap?
A: Bitcoin’s first-mover advantage, limited supply, strong security model, and global recognition as digital gold keep it at the top.

Q: Is investing in large-cap cryptos safer than small-cap ones?
A: Generally yes—large-cap cryptos have proven track records and broader adoption, reducing volatility risk compared to speculative small caps.

Q: How often does the ranking of top cryptos change?
A: The top 5–10 usually remain stable over years, though mid-tier rankings shift frequently based on trends and innovation.

Q: Can stablecoins like USDT and USDC be profitable investments?
A: They don’t appreciate in value but offer stability and yield opportunities through staking or lending platforms.

Q: What happens if a crypto loses its top market cap position?
A: It may face reduced investor confidence, but strong fundamentals can still support long-term value even outside the top ranks.

Q: Should I only invest in top cryptos by market cap?
A: A balanced approach includes top cryptos for stability plus selective exposure to promising mid-caps for growth potential.
